Immediately disclosing that this is unconfirmed information, the source published a timetable for the release of platforms that support DDR5 memory. According to this chart, Intel will be the first to release the Z690 chipset and LGA1700 Alder Lake processors in the fourth quarter of this year. In the first quarter of 2022, the B660 and H410 chipsets will be released for these processors. And only in the next, that is, in the second quarter of 2022, AMD will present its platform with DDR5 support, including the X670 chipset and Raphael processors. In the third quarter, the lineup of the Intel Z790 chipset will come. Boards on it will still be equipped with an LGA1700 socket, but it will be possible to install not only Alder Lake processors, but also Reptor Lake processors. The graph is clearly shown below:
